今天看完病人在洗手的時候,發現水特別熱,想說,是不是加護病房的洗手水溫有特別意義呢?

這個問題最先想到的就是就是阿長,之後又去查了一下文獻,最後在問一下資深護理人員

結果最後的結果是..沒有特別意義

那為何會有熱水呢?

因為護士常常造洗手,天氣冷,洗冷水手部舒服,所以改用熱水

但是如果又太熱的水,手更容易乾燥,所以建議都用溫水。

不過的確有部分文獻說,溫的肥皂水或是含有滅菌成分的水可以幫助清潔更多細菌:

http://web.archive.org/web/20080325225216/www.cfsan.fda.gov/~dms/a2z-h.html

Hot water that is comfortable for washing hands is not hot enough to kill bacteria. Bacteria grows much faster at body temperature (37 C). However, warm, soapy water is more effective than cold, soapy water at removing the natural oils on your hands which hold soils and bacteria.

Laestadius JG, Dimberg L (April 2005). "Hot water for handwashing—where is the proof?"J. Occup. Environ. Med. 47 (4): 434–5.

Contrary to popular belief however, scientific studies have shown that using warm water has no effect on reducing the microbial load on hands.

http://health.howstuffworks.com/skin-care/cleansing/basics/hand-washing2.htm

You've probably been told that it's best to wash your hands in hot water because it helps to kill bacteria, but that is actually not the case. Adult skin can begin to scald at 120 degrees Fahrenheit (49 degrees Celsius), but studies have shown that hands washed using water up to that temperature still don't remove bacteria
